Effect of Increased Ionizing Radiation and Near-Null Magnetic Field on Electrical Signals of Plants

Research RF Safe Research Library Jan 1, 2025

This experimental study examined how increased β ionizing radiation (31.3 μGy/h) and hypomagnetic conditions (0–1.5 μT) affect plant electrical signaling responses to stimuli. It reports enhanced electrical signals under increased ionizing radiation and weakened signals under near-null magnetic field conditions. The authors suggest these effects may be mediated by changes in reactive oxygen species involved in stress signaling.

A Prolonged exposure to Wi-Fi Radiation Induces Neurobehavioral Changes and Oxidative Stress in Adult Zebrafish

Research RF Safe Research Library Jan 1, 2025

This animal study exposed adult zebrafish to 2.45 GHz Wi‑Fi radiation for 4 hours daily over 30 consecutive days. The authors report neurobehavioral impairments with altered locomotion, alongside decreased acetylcholinesterase and increased brain oxidative stress. They conclude these findings indicate a safety risk and call for further mechanistic and public health research.

The influence of Wi-Fi on the mesonephros in the 9-day-old chicken embryo

Research RF Safe Research Library Jan 1, 2025

This animal study examined continual 2.4 GHz Wi‑Fi exposure (200–500 μW/m²) during 9 days of chicken embryo incubation and assessed the mesonephros at day 9. The authors report no adverse effects on general mesonephros development, but describe moderate degenerative changes and vascular congestion without inflammatory infiltrate. They also report significantly increased apoptotic and proliferating cells and up-regulation of caspase‑1 gene expression, interpreted as disruption of regulatory processes during development.

The Impact of Mobile Phone Electromagnetic Waves on the Neurons and Blood Brain Barrier Integrity in the Chick Embryo

Research RF Safe Research Library Jan 1, 2024

This animal study exposed chick embryos to electromagnetic waves from a mobile phone and compared them with unexposed controls. Electron microscopy on days 10 and 15 reported neuronal and cerebellar cellular alterations in the exposed group, including features described as apoptosis and mitochondrial swelling. The authors also report compromised blood-brain barrier integrity and conclude the exposure adversely affects brain development.

Bibliography of reported biological phenomena ("effects") and clinical manifestations attributed to microwave and radio-frequency radiation

Research RF Safe Research Library Jan 1, 1971

This item is a bibliography of reported biological phenomena and clinical manifestations attributed to radio-frequency and microwave radiation. It compiles over 2000 references published up to June 1971, with supplemental listings through Nov. 21, 1971, and gives particular attention to reported effects in humans. The abstract does not describe any systematic synthesis or conclusions about health effects.
